Dan Christian set to make international comeback against Windies

Australia head coach Justin Langer has confirmed that all-rounder Dan Christian will make his international comeback in the side’s first T20I against West Indies on Friday.

“He’s finally worn me down, ‘Christo’,” Langer said in the pre-match presser.

Notably, Christian had made his last appearance for Australia against India in Ranchi in 2017.

“I’ve been in the (head coach) job three years and every time he gets some runs in any game or competition around the world, he texts me and says ‘Coach I’m ready to go, pick me, I’m the best allrounder in Australia’,” he added.

Further praising the all-rounder, the coach said: “He’s a fantastic bloke; he’s got an amazing set of hands in the field (and) he’s clever with the ball. His experience, and we’ve seen throughout the Big Bash and all around the world actually, he hits the ball as clean as anyone.”

“It’s almost becoming an urban myth, isn’t it? Wherever he plays, we win. He’s so excited, he’s probably a bit nervous tonight — so excited about playing for Australia again — and I just love seeing that, love seeing that energy,” concluded he.
